New Delhi:
A Delhi court docket Thursday granted bail to 76 international nationals from 8 international locations who had been chargesheeted for attending the Delhi mosque occasion in Nizamuddin by allegedly violating visa situations, indulging in missionary actions illegally and violating authorities tips, issued within the wake of COVID-19 outbreak.
Chief Metropolitan Magistrate Gurmohina Kaur granted the aid to the foreigners upon furnishing a private bond of Rs 10,000 every.
The accused will file their plea discount functions on Friday, stated advocate Ashima Mandla, showing for a number of the international nationals.
Under plea discount, the accused pleaded responsible to the offence praying for a lesser punishment. The Criminal Procedure of Code permits plea discount for instances the place the utmost punishment is imprisonment for seven years, the place offences do not have an effect on the socio-economic situations of the society and when the offences should not dedicated towards a lady or a baby beneath 14 years.
During the listening to, all of the international nationals had been produced earlier than the court docket by way of video conferencing.
The foreigners belong to Mali, Nigeria, Sri Lanka, Kenya, Djibouti, Tanzania, South Africa and Myanmar, stated advocates Mandakini Singh, Fahim Khan and Ahmad Khan, showing for the accused.
